Le Parvis de Sainte-Thérèse
Le Parvis de Sainte-Thérèse is an apartment building in Loire-Atlantique, Pays de la Loire. Le Parvis de Sainte-Thérèse is situated nearby to the marketplace Marché des Américains, as well as near the church Église Sainte-Thérèse (Nantes).Places of Interest Nearby

Nantes
Photo: Jibi44,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Nantes is the capital of Pays de la Loire region in northwest France. Historically it was part of Brittany, whose dukes built up its castle and made the town their capital.
